Webinar on health challenges, solutions held


Published : 11 Sep 2020 09:54 PM

A daylong webinar on “health services: challenges and way and means during corona virus” was held in Jheniah on Thursday. Jhenidah civil surgeon office and Jhenidah Sadar hospital with the association of committee of concern citizens (CCC) Jhenidah unit jointly organized the webinar.

District health department and service receivers participated in the zoom conference to identify the limitations in treatment and solutions. 

Presided over and conducted by CCC president Sayedul Alam, deputy commissioner Saroj Kumar Nath attended as chief guest. Civil surgeon Dr. Salina Bagum, Jhenidah Sadar hospital superintendent Dr. Harun Or Rashid, Jhenidah Sadar UNO Badruddoza Subho attended as special guests.

Two women and eight male participants including corona fighter Dr. Jakir Hossain, transparency International (TI) Bangladesh civic engagement director Farhana Ferdous and Saiful Mabud among others expressed their opinion.

 Chief guest deputy commissioner Saroj Kumar Nath considering the problems, assured of probable solutions to the limitations in improving the health services.

Saroj Kumar Nath said the proposals could be placed in district level upcoming departmental and administrative meetings and forwarded to concern ministry for resolve the crisis gradually. He had suggested to apply to the ministry of health to ensure supply of adequate machineries and equipments for Jhenidah Sadar hospital and dedicated covid 19 hospital. 

He also advised the people to wear mask, use hand sanitizers and preserve mini soap with everybody for a safer cleanness whenever someone comes outside the houses.

Civil surgeon Dr. Salian Begum in her speech admiring the activities of the health department amid global pandemic corona virus, said the sample collection of the covid 19 was least due to short supply of materials. He advised the people to realize the limitations of the government and show patience getting services.

The zoom conference had put some suggestions like establishing 50 bed isolation hospital for covid 19 patients, serve cordially to the patients tested corona positive, deploy adequate physicians, nurses and medical technologists, post various corona updates in civil surgeon office website and face book of corona spokesman at a regular basis.

The conference also suggested to set up specific board for sample collection spots, ensure cleanness of sample collection room, arrange sitting arrangements for patients, supply adequate machineries in government hospitals, introduce mobile phone service, ensure monitoring services and treatment at private hospitals and clinics, using of mask mandatory at public transports, ensure accountability of physicians, nurses and other health staffs showing soft corners to the infected or suspected people and enhance the budget in health sectors.
